What Warehouse Operations contributes to Cardinal Health

Operations is responsible for materials handling and product distribution in a distribution or manufacturing environment. Includes warehousing and fulfillment of materials and products, transportation, inventory management as well as demand, supply and manufacturing planning.

Warehouse Operations is responsible for performing/controlling a combination of manual or automated tasks necessary for the receipt, storage, and shipment of product. This may include functions of receiving, picking, packing, shipping, staging, transporting, storage, delivery, etc. Also responsible for the efficient flow of products from the point of product receipt from vendors to the shipment of products (via prescribed service parameters) to a variety of internal and external customers.

Job Summary

The Supervisor, Warehouse Operations supervises a team of Associates and ensures that pick, pack, and ship operations are safe, efficient, and of high quality. With responsibility for a day or night shift, the Supervisor continually monitors efficiency and quality metrics, assigns work and provides coaching to supervised staff, and addresses a variety of operational issues. The Supervisor directly contributes to Cardinal Health’s customer service reputation by ensuring that shipments are on-time and of high quality, develops the Warehouse Operations talent pool, and enhances operational excellence.

Responsibilities

  • Supervises the daily work assignments and performance of Group Leads and Associates. Tracks efficiency and productivity metrics to determine which tasks are behind- and ahead-of-schedule, and provides hands-on guidance to Associates to ensure that pick, pack, and ship tasks are completed correctly and safely.
  • Ensures that all warehouse systems are ready and schedules and prioritizes the work that each Group Lead and team of Associates will complete. Tracks employee attendance and ensures necessary employee headcount to achieve objectives.
  • Monitors continually productivity and quality metrics including cycle times, lines per hour, shortages, damaged units, missed dispatches, and missed scans, among others. Regularly reports on team performance to the Manager, Warehouse Operations.
  • Determines the productivity or safety issue root cause and directs supervised staff on resolving the issue and maintaining operations. Promptly and thoroughly documents the issue and communicates the root cause and resolution to the Manager, Supervisors, and other internal stakeholders as necessary.
  • Proactively identifies opportunities to improve operations and mitigate risks within supervised team and broader warehouse operations. Provides input into operational excellence initiatives and ensures that there are implemented correctly within own area.
  • Conducts performance evaluations and provides one-on-one feedback to encourage Associates’ development. Identifies Associates capable of working as Group Leads. Creates performance improvement plans for staff and administers discipline when necessary.
  • Participates in the interviewing and selection of new Associates and provides trainings during employee onboarding.
